Morningstar Commodities Broad Basket Category Average: Broad-basket portfolios can invest in a diversified basket of commodity goods including but not limited to grains, minerals, metals, livestock, cotton, oils, sugar, coffee, and cocoa. Investment can be made directly in physical assets or commodity-linked derivative instruments, such as commodity swap agreements.
Bloomberg Commodity Index is a broadly diversified futures index currently composed of futures contracts on 23 physical commodities. The Index is weighted among commodity sectors using dollar-adjusted liquidity and production data.
An investment cannot be made directly in an index or average. All indexes and averages are unmanaged.

Beta measures a fund's sensitivity to changes in the overall market relative to its benchmark. Standard deviation depicts how widely returns vary around its average and is used to understand the range of returns most likely for a given fund. A higher standard deviation generally implies greater volatility. Turnover Ratio is the rate of trading in a portfolio, higher values imply more frequent trading. An investment cannot be made directly in an index. Due to data availability, statistics may not be as of the current reporting period.
Enhanced cash strategies are variations on traditional money market vehicles. They are designed to provide liquidity and principal preservation, but with more of an emphasis on seeking returns that are superior to those of traditional money market offerings.
